Archive, reactivate, and delete a trip
Put a finished trip away, bring it back, or remove it for good, and what happens to its plans and ballots along the way.
When a trip is over (or shelved), archive it: it leaves the Home screen for the whole crew, but nothing is lost. Archived trips live in Settings → Archived Trips, where organizers can bring them back or delete them permanently.
Archive a trip
Archiving is for the trip owner and crew with edit permission. organizer
- 1Open the trip and tap the gear in the top-right corner.
- 2Tap Archive.
- 3Confirm, and the alert reminds you this also archives all the trip's activities.
- 4You're returned to Home, and the trip is gone from everyone's trip list.

What archiving means:
- Plans are archived along with the trip.
- Ballots disappear from everyone's Decisions inbox while the trip is archived. Deadlines keep counting down, though; a ballot whose deadline passes resolves with the votes already cast.
- Its Trip Pass is untouched. Archiving is reversible, so a locked-in trip keeps its pass; nothing is spent and nothing is refunded. Reactivate it and the trip is back exactly as it was. (See Trip Passes.)
- The archive shows in the trip log, and the crew can be notified depending on their settings.
Heads up
Archived trips can't be opened; there's no read-only view. To look inside one again, reactivate it first.
The Archived Trips screen
Settings → Archived Trips lists every archived trip you're on (cover photo, name, destination, and when it was archived) with a count in the header. Pull down to refresh. Anyone can view the list; the buttons are organizer-only. member
Archiving and permanent deletion work offline. The trip moves into Archived Trips immediately, where an organizer can still use the red trash button; both changes wait safely in the sync queue until the connection returns. Reactivate needs a connection and appears again when you're online. organizer

Reactivate a trip
Reactivating is organizer-only: non-organizers see an "Organizers only" hint instead of buttons, and the server blocks the change for them too. organizer
- 1Go to Settings → Archived Trips.
- 2Tap Reactivate on the trip.
- 3Confirm, and the trip and all its plans move back to the trips list for everyone on the trip.
Note
Reactivated trips return exactly as they were, plans, ballots, and crew intact.
Delete a trip permanently
Deletion lives on the same screen, behind the red trash button, also organizer-only. organizer
Tap the trash icon and confirm: the trip and all its plans are deleted for everyone on the trip, and this cannot be undone. There is no recovery; if you're not sure, leave the trip archived instead; it costs nothing to keep.
Deleting a locked-in trip and its Trip Pass
Deleting behaves differently from archiving where a Trip Pass is concerned, because delete is permanent:
- A trip you never confirmed costs nothing to delete. Planning is always free, so if the owner never chose Confirm trip from the gear, no pass was spent; there's nothing to refund and nothing to lose.
- Delete within an hour of locking in and the pass comes back. Locked a trip in and immediately changed your mind? If an organizer deletes it within an hour, the spent pass returns to the trip owner's balance automatically; an accidental lock-in never costs you.
- After that hour, the pass stays spent. Once the grace window passes, the pass has done its job; deleting the trip (or deleting and recreating it) won't win it back.
- On a Planner Pass, there's nothing to refund. Lock-ins covered by the Planner Pass subscription never touch a pass balance in the first place, so deleting one of those trips doesn't move any numbers.
Note
Only the trip owner spends or gets back a pass; it's always tied to whoever locked the trip in. Buying and spending Trip Passes is currently available on iOS.
Permissions
- Archive: owner and crew with edit permission. organizer
- Reactivate: organizers only, server-enforced. organizer
- Delete permanently: organizers only, from Settings → Archived Trips. organizer
- View the archived list: anyone. member
